Understanding McAfee's Scam Detector Capabilities

McAfee's Scam Detector has raised the bar in scam detection with its noteworthy claim of 99% accuracy. The tool employs advanced algorithms to identify scams and spoofing attempts, even on video platforms where deepfakes are becoming increasingly common.

Its ability to provide real-time alerts on platforms like WhatsApp and Gmail positions it as a powerful tool for users who engage in constant online communication. However, the premium access to this utility restricts less tech-savvy users from reaping its benefits without a subscription.


Exploring Free Alternatives to McAfee's Scam Detector

Thankfully, alternatives do exist for those who are budget-conscious or simply prefer freeware. Here are some noteworthy free tools and strategies to protect against scams:

  • Microsoft Defender: Pre-installed on Windows machines, it provides dependable phishing protection and system scanning capabilities.
  • Avast Free Antivirus: Offers anti-phishing security and regular virus updates to keep your system secure.
  • Malwarebytes Free: This tool excels in detecting and removing malware, making it an excellent backup to traditional antivirus software.
  • Adaware Antivirus Free: Apart from typical antivirus features, it includes web protection against phishing attacks.

These tools are not only free but are frequently updated, ensuring users are protected against the latest threats.

Enhancing Security on Various Platforms

McAfee's offering promises contextual alerts on communication platforms, but similar protections can be attained through judicious use of free software and built-in features. Regularly updating your passwords, enabling two-factor authentication, and being vigilant about unsolicited communications are key practices that defend against scams.
